Regarding this, what are yellow tomatoes called?Yellow, gold and orange tomatoes are less acidic and taste sweeter. Some yellow varieties (also sometimes called white tomatoes) can also seem a little bland because they are so low in acidity.Similarly, are yellow tomatoes lower in acid? Most yellow tomatoes are less tangy than red tomatoes. Many but not all orange and yellow tomatoes are lower in acid content than red tomatoes. Some orange and yellow tomatoes are almost acid free. Slicing Tomatoes The beefsteak heirloom “Basinga” has the best clear yellow color complemented by a sweet, somewhat mild taste. “Hugh’s” heirloom tomato has large fragrant fruit characterized as “peachy-sweet.” Heirloom “Tangerine” grows well in cool-summer climates and is a heavy producer.Are yellow tomatoes edible?Yellow cherry tomatoes are slightly less acidic than red varieties, and therefore they are somewhat milder and sweeter in flavor. Yellow cherry tomatoes are tender-firm and thin-skinned with two seed cavities carrying tiny, edible seeds.
